D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Develop & maintain the Enterprise Security Architecture (ESA) strategy, roadmap & capabilities matrix, outlining capabilities (current & future: tools, technologies & processes), with path to achieve optimal maturity.
  • Create & maintain the ESA diagrams depicting capabilities, identify duplicates, gaps & provide actionable recommendations.
  • Update and maintain the client's Zero Trust strategy & develops the Zero trust Architecture (ZTA) implementation plan & integrates into the roadmap.
  • Leads assessments & evaluations of new or replacement capabilities and tools to meet future or changing needs. This includes tool functionality and complexity of implementation, compliance with client & NIST requirements, & interoperability with existing or planned capabilities.
  • Plans & conducts Proof of Concept (PoC) deployments within the client enterprise and/or in external vendor environments.
  • Understands & evaluates business, technical & functional requirements, translating mission goals & operational directives into actional recommendations.
  • Understand requirements, use cases, implementation challenges, client road maps & operational pain points
  • Designs solutions for existing & ongoing implementations & supports implementation efforts. This includes tool evaluation, adoption, implementation & phase-out; system integration development and implementation; and feature/content development.
  • Develops schedules, work breakdown structures (WBS's) & project schedules.
  • Collaborates with internal & external teams & ensures client & NIST compliance.
  • Serves as a Team Lead and provides services as a cross functional team member - support other Task Areas as required.
  • Ensures all SLA's are met.
